Ruch Chorzów is a historic and iconic football institution in Poland, currently competing in the second-tier Poland Liga 1. Based in Chorzów, the club's storied past is etched into Polish football lore, with their home being the legendary Stadion Ruchu. Founded in 1920, the team wears iconic blue shirts, earning them the nickname "Niebieski" (The Blues). Ruch is one of the most decorated clubs in Polish history, having won the national championship a record number of times during the mid-20th century, an era defined by legendary players and dominant teams. Their rivalry with Górnik Zabrze is one of the country's most intense. After facing financial difficulties and relegation in recent decades, the club is now on a mission to return to its rightful place in the Ekstraklasa. The modern era sees Ruch rebuilding, with a focus on developing young players and reconnecting with its massive, passionate fan base. The supporters of Ruch are known for their unwavering devotion, creating one of the most impressive atmospheres in Polish football regardless of the division. The club's culture is built on tradition, pride, and a relentless will to fight. Ruch Chorzów remains a sleeping giant, with every season in Liga 1 viewed as a step towards reviving past glories and restoring the club to the top of the Polish game.
